In this chat, Alex Bogaard, a landscape and wildlife photographer, shares his journey driven by emotional connections in his work. He delves into balancing artistic integrity with commercial demands, emphasizing the importance of preparation and flexibility on shoots. Alex discusses how to create emotional resonance in images and the thrill of unexpected moments in nature. He also touches on the value of maintaining a personal connection to photography, ensuring joy doesn't fade when making it a business.

Build A Landscape From Back To Front

  • Build landscape images from background to foreground and treat the scene as a stage.
  • Add an 'actor' (animal, person, cloud, light) to create story, scale, and emotional depth.

Move To Place The Horizon Intentionally

  • Mind horizon placement and change your vantage to avoid distracting lines across subjects.
  • Lower or raise your position to move the horizon away from an animal's or person's head.
